Partially decomposed corpse found in Kg Pandan Dalam
Police are encouraging members of the public to come forward with information regarding the partially decomposed body found in Ampang yesterday. – Screengrab, January 11, 2021

KUALA LUMPUR – The partially decomposed body of a man was found by the public in a shrub area at Jalan F, Kg Pandan Dalam, Ampang here yesterday.

Ampang Jaya district deputy police chief Mohd Azam Ismail said the public informed police about the body at about 7.30pm.

“Preliminary investigations at the scene found that the body discovered by the public was in a semi-rotten condition.

“The body is believed to be that of an adult male. He was fully clothed but no identity document was found at the scene,” he said in a statement today.

He said that so far, no criminal element has been detected and investigations are still ongoing, including to identify the victim’s citizenship status.

He said the body has been sent to the Chancellor Tuanku Muhriz Hospital here for a post-mortem. The case was classified as sudden death.

Azam asks members of the public who have information related to the case to come forward to testify at the Ampang Police Station or call 03-4289-7417. – Bernama, January 11, 2021
